Two sufferers died at a hospital in Odisha’s Keonjhar district allegedly attributable to flawed blood group transfusion. A probe has been ordered into the incident for the alleged negligence on the a part of a hospital attendant and two technicians of the blood financial institution, in accordance with experiences.
As such, listed below are just a few necessary issues to grasp about blood transfusion practices.
Why are blood transfusions performed?
Blood transfusion helps change blood misplaced to damage or throughout surgical procedure, or any such medical circumstances. “Typically, RBC (pink blood cell) transfusions are carried out with the intention to extend arterial oxygen content material and thus oxygen supply to the tissues,” in accordance with a examine revealed in Nationwide Heart for Biotechnology Data (NCBI).

How is transfusion carried out?
All exams are carried out to establish the compatibility of the transfused blood. Throughout blood transfusion, a small needle is positioned within the vein of your arm via which blood is transfused. Medical workers displays all of the very important parameters when transfusion is being performed, stated Dr Manjusha Agarwal, Senior Advisor-Inside Medication at World Hospital Parel Mumbai. She added that it normally it takes “upto 4 hours to finish a transfusion, in emergencies, it may be transfused even at a sooner price.”
Danger components
The essential factor to grasp is that “for those who obtain blood that’s not suitable together with your blood, your physique produces antibodies to destroy the donor’s blood cells. That is referred to as transfusion response”, stated the skilled.
In keeping with Dr Agarwal, transfusion response could be within the type of fever, hives and itching. “In extreme circumstances, lung damage can occur. Micro organism current in donors could cause an infection within the recipient. Acute kidney damage attributable to hemolytic response may also happen,” Dr Manjusha defined.
How you can stop human error when receiving blood
In keeping with Dr Sangeeta Agarwal, senior advisor, Division of Transfusion Medication, Fortis Memorial Analysis Institute, Gurugram,
*Double verify the blood particulars earlier than each transfusion by retesting.
*Ensure the recipient and donor particulars are actualities – they’re proved with proof.
*Accurately labeling gadgets in storage.
Submit-transfusion care
Submit-transfusion, there could also be an ache within the arm or bruising on the web site of transfusion. “There’s a very small threat of delayed response which may trigger nausea, swelling, jaundice, or itchy rash. Please seek the advice of your physician for those who really feel unwell post-transfusion,” suggested Dr Manjusha .
